Automobile

Richard:    $4,500
Neil C:    $4,210
Nick:    $3,810
Mike:    $3,530
Darren:    $3,150

Well ... I tried to ban Richard from this game, as he has played it numerous times in play-test mode, and we all (quite rightly, as it turned out) assumed he was going to beat us. Neil actually ran him quite close, although he'd played a game and a half before too, while the rest of us plodded along. We all really enjoyed it, however, but it is definitely one of those games that you have to play half a game of before you get it all. Looking back, the three of us let Richard and Neil produced hundreds of little cheap cars while we all concentrated on the mid-price and luxury ones. Darren had a mid-round where he under-produced, which seemed to cost him pretty heavy.  A very good game, and one we want to play again pretty soon.

Small World

Neil C:    82
Richard:    80
Nick:    79
Darren:    78
Mike:    72

This was ridiculously close. I had a couple of quiet rounds to start with, having taken ghouls and declined them in round 2, but then I went a bit mad with my Commando Orcs and started scoring quite high, which drew a lot of attention. The finger-pointing started then, and I cam under attack from all sides. In retaliation, I did what I could to disrupt Richard and Mike, but Neil sneakily snuck under the radar, watched the rest of us beat each other up, and grabbed a 7-point "wealthy" bonus to nudge him ahead of the rest of us in the final turn.
